     Your Committee on Judiciary, to which was referred H.B. No. 93 entitled:

 

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O ORGANIZATIONAL REPORTS,"

 

begs le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ose and intent of this measure is to require the Campaign Spending Commission to publish on its website the names of candidates and persons who qualify as noncandidate committees who fail to file an organizational report or a corrected organizational report with the Campaign Spending Commission.

 

     Your Committee received testimony in support of this measure from the Campaign Spending Commission, Commission to Improve Standards of Conduct, and two individuals.

 

     Your Committee finds that a noncandidate committee cannot file required disclosure reports without first registering with the Campaign Spending Commission by filing an organizational report.  Your Committee further finds that organizational reports should be timely filed and the failure to file organizational reports should be disclosed to the public in some manner.  This measure will allow the Campaign Spending Commission to publish the names of noncandidate committees who fail to file an organizational report, which will motivate them to do so.

 

     As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Judiciary that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 93, and recommends that it pass Second Reading and be placed on the calendar for Third Reading.
